Cost of repairing upvc windows
The type of window and the work needed will determine the cost of upvc window repairs near me. Most often, repairs to a double-paned window will cost more than repairs to a single-pane window.
It is possible to replace your window's seals and hinges. A broken window spring could cause the sash to stick when you attempt to open the window. A broken lock or handle can also make your windows vulnerable to burglars.
There are a variety of reasons your windows need to be repaired. Broken glass, hinges that aren't aligned correctly or loose hinges are just a few of the reasons your windows need to be repaired. Other causes are faulty seals, or a faulty balance or spring.
DIY window repair upvc windows is a cost-effective option if you're looking to fix your windows. Before you begin you should be aware of what you'll pay on the repairs.
It's cheaper to replace a single pane of glass than to replace a whole windows, according to most homeowners. It is possible to save hundreds of dollars by fixing your windows instead of replacing them.
The costs for replacing windows that are damaged can be extremely high, but. The cost can be high due to the possibility of wood rot due to exposure to moisture. You'll have to remove all rotten sections from the frame and replace them with new.
Depending on the size of your window, you could pay between $75-$300 to have your windows repaired. It's important to know that you'll need a couple to do this and if you have more than one window, it's likely you'll save money.
You will need to buy the screen to replace your window screens. Screens can be priced differently depending on their thickness and mesh material. Screen replacements range from $150 to $350.
You'll have to think about how long it takes to complete the job. The majority of companies charge by the hour, so you may want to take a look at the prices to determine what you can manage to pay for.
